Summary

In July 1958, an observer at Randolph Air Force Base in Texas spotted a luminous object that appeared like a bright star. The report details that the object, the size of a pinhead, was moving in a straight line toward the northeast while fading as it approached the horizon. The observer used binoculars and recorded the sighting for 35 seconds. Although initially considered the possibility of a balloon or aircraft, it was concluded to be likely a satellite. In fact, the satellite Sputnik 1958 Delta 2 passed near the area around the same time, suggesting the sighting could have been of this object.

The report includes detailed weather data and trajectory calculations supporting the theory that the object was a satellite. The observer's description, along with the matching time and location, reinforces the idea that it was not an unknown phenomenon but a known space object. This case is a classic example of how UFO reports often can be explained by natural or technological phenomena.
